- Description
- NOWY-HEADED WHITE MARBLE TABLET SET INTO A SHAPED GREEN MARBLE FRAME WITH INSCRIPTION IN BLACK LETTERING. CARVED RELIEF IN THE CENTRE OF THE TABLET. FLAG CARVED IN RELIEF IN THE CENTRE WITH ANGELS WINGS IN LOW RELIEF BEHIND IT. A ROYAL BRITISH LEGION FLAG SITS ON EACH SIDE OF THE TABLET.
- Inscription
- left side: IN EVER / LOVING / MEMORY OF / THOSE OF / THIS PARISH / WHO FELL IN THE / GREAT WAR / 1914 - 1919 right-side: (16 names) base: ERECTED BY THEIR RELATIVES
